War Council At White House Discusses Future Plans

Washington June 18 Special A war council met at the White House with President McKinley Secretaries Long and Alger Gen Miles Admiral Sicard and Captain Mahan present for two hours. No details were released though it was deemed of major importance Alger denies dissatisfaction with Miles and notes Miles was recalled to discuss campaign adjustments. Larger drafts for troops may trigger a third call but only after equipment is arranged.

Wanda brings Cuban front news of Santiago bombardment

Kinaston June 18 Special dispatch reports the Wanda arriving with week’s Cuba campaign details. Outer fortifications of Santiago practically demolished ahead of expected troops and Guan tanamo harbor occupation. Spanish commander exhausted, half rations, supplies to end of June. Insurgent General Perez says 1200 troops will reinforce marines soon. Insurgents praised for daring and fighting spirit with good shoes and Lee Metford rifles.

Saturday's Market Prices Trim Fruit and Veg Decline

Market notes slow fall in fruit and vegetables with mixed slips in prices. Strawberries down, others steady. radishes 20c a dozen, cucumbers 5c each, tomatoes 2bc a basket, green and wax beans 6c lb, new potatoes 80c peck, lettuce 3c per bundle, celery 40c a dozen, oranges 10 to 50c a dozen, bananas 5 to 10c a dozen, dairy butter 16c lb, creamery 20c lb.

Britain cancels annual naval manoeuvres amid coal crisis

London reports Britain will skip the usual naval manoeuvres this year amid speculation about coal shortages from the Welsh miners strike. Some say the decision stems from fuel limits while others predict major events upcoming. The Star debunks a Paris-made tale that Capt. Gen. Augusti handed Manila to the German fleet commander to protect inhabitants from insurgents.

Republican Primary Election in Freeport Township

Republican voters in Freeport Township will hold a primal election Friday afternoon June 24 to express a preference for county offices and to elect delegates to the county convention. Polls open 5 to 8 p m with precinct voting at Bergman and Dorman's office Williams House Mayer's restaurant Lachmacher's store Journal office Brandt's grocery Pennsylvania House and a grocery on Elk Street.
